Bullick Hollow Road - Tree Cutting and Other Work In Progress |
On Feb 6th, Don Ward (far left in photo) of Travis County's Roadway Maintenance Division met with Peter Strickland (center), other Strickland family members and Lonnie Moore discuss the tree trimming that has begun on Bullick Hollow Road. Mr. Ward explained that BHR has one of the highest accident rates in Travis County and the County is trying to improve line-of-sight, as well as preparing for some roadway improvements to begin in April. The County will be providing a surface treatment and restriping the roadway. Perhaps more important, Mr. Ward stated they now plan to improve the shoulders in a manner similar to what TXDOT did on FM 2769.
The Stricklands expressed concerns that the County might be cutting too aggressively, unncecessarily removing to much of the natural buffer that the trees provide to residents of BHR. At the end of the meeting, it appeared an understanding had been reached as to the level of clearing that would be achieved. |
